The Melted Ice Pop Top is a drop shoulder sweater with both a long sleeve and short sleeve pattern option. Worked top down, starting with the back panel and casting on the shoulders and then the front panel to connect in the round under the arms. Sleeves are picked up and knitted top down. The edges are finished with an I-cord bind off.

There are linked video tutorials for both types of I-Cord Bindoff.

Genevieve is 5’10” with a 33” chest, she’s wearing the long sleeve version in a size M and the short sleeve in a size S.

Gauge: 16 stitches x 23 Rows in stockinette on 5.5mm needles = 4”x4”

Yarn: Cascade Yarns Nifty Cotton Splash
Long Sleeve is 217 Rink Side
Short Sleeve is 221 Ambrosia

Needle: 5.5 mm US 9 for body & sleeves
5 mm US 8 for I-Cord edges

Sizes: XS(S,M,L) XL{XXL,2XL,3XL} 4XL(5XL,6XL)

Yardage:

982(1066,1157,1281) 1385{1498,1596,1730} 1828(1955,2058) for long sleeve

779(863,952,1056) 1154{1257,1358,1478} 1576(1694,1804) for short sleeve

Skills: Picking up stitches, I-Cord edging, K2TOG, M1R
